    ASMARA (Olympic Solidarity Technical course for coaches) – The technical course for coaches took place in the Eritrea’s capital city Asmara from the 1st to the 12th November 2010. The theoretical sessions were hosted in the Eritrea Olympic Association offices and practical sessions were on Boca Fila, an open-air basketball court nearby.

    Mr. Owino Ronald Onyango, host to this programme in the past, conducted the beginner-level courses for 29 participants (27 men and 2 women). The main objective was to develop specific skills and knowledge in order to improve management of young teams.

    A series of techniques were used to cover topics such as the philosophy of coaching and leadership, effective communication, fundamental basketball skills, and scouting. Open discussions allowed coaches to exchange experiences, furthering the value of the clinic. During the practical sessions, players from local basketball clubs participated to help illustrate theories learned throughout the course.
